Where does this role fit in? We are seeking an organized, detail-oriented, and collaborative Procurement Operations Specialist to serve as the end-to-end owner of our vendor management process. Based in the Philippines, this role serves as a vital operational bridge connecting internal application owners with Finance, Legal, IT Operations, and Security teams to ensure seamless vendor onboarding, renewals, and financial processing. The ideal candidate possesses financial acumen and actively leverages AI tools and digital automation to drive speed, accuracy, and efficiency across procurement and finance workflows. What will you do? Vendor Management & Process Ownership Process Ownership: Serve as the end-to-end owner of the vendor management process, ensuring a smooth, compliant, and efficient procurement lifecycle. Subject Matter Expertise: Act as the internal Subject Matter Expert (SME) for all things related to vendor procurement, renewals, and contract expansions.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ner closely with Finance, Legal, IT Operations, and Security teams to ensure all vendor agreements meet financial, legal, technical, and security requirements. Internal Liaison: Act as the primary bridge between internal application owners and the various cross-functional teams required to action and approve vendor requests. External Partner Management: Serve as the main point of contact and liaison with our third-party procurement consultant to maximize savings. Financial Administration & Budget Control (Essential) Budget Verification: Conduct preliminary budget checking for all incoming vendor requests to ensure alignment with department allocations prior to commercial commitments. PR & PO Management: Take ownership of initiating Purchase Order (PO) creation, and tracking approvals through the finance pipeline. Financial Accuracy: Match vendor invoices against contracts/POs to identify and resolve cost variances in close collaboration with the Finance team. Process Automation, AI & Innovation Process Automation & Innovation: Collaborate with our automation engineering team to continuously review, optimize, and improve the vendor workflows. Leveraging AI Tools: Actively utilize AI and modern digital tools (e.g.Claude), analyze spend data, and accelerate daily administrative workflows. Inventory & Asset Management Inventory & Asset Management: Meticulously maintain our centralized contract and application inventory, ensuring data integrity for renewals and compliance.
